projects
/
ghc-hetmet.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
fix haddock submodule pointer
[ghc-hetmet.git]
/
compiler
/
iface
/ TcIface.lhs
2011-06-14
Adam Megacz
merge upstream
commit
|
commitdiff
2011-06-03
Manuel M T Chakravarty
Propagate scalar variables and tycons for vectorisation...
commit
|
commitdiff
2011-05-31
Adam Megacz
merge GHC HEAD
commit
|
commitdiff
2011-05-12
Jose Pedro Magalhaes
Merge branch 'master' of darcs.haskell.org/ghc into...
commit
|
commitdiff
2011-05-12
Simon Peyton Jones
The final batch of changes for the new coercion represe...
commit
|
commitdiff
2011-05-02
Jose Pedro Magalhaes
Remove the hasGenerics field of TyCon, improve the...
commit
|
commitdiff
2011-04-19
Simon Peyton Jones
This BIG PATCH contains most of the work for the New...
commit
|
commitdiff
2011-03-09
Adam Megacz
make exports/imports of depth>0 identifiers work correctly
commit
|
commitdiff
2010-12-22
simonpj@microsoft.com
Make mkDFunUnfolding more robust
commit
|
commitdiff
2010-12-13
simonpj@microsoft.com
Fix recursive superclasses (again). Fixes Trac #4809.
commit
|
commitdiff
2010-11-18
simonpj@microsoft.com
Fix the generation of in-scope variables for IfaceLint...
commit
|
commitdiff
2010-10-27
simonpj@microsoft.com
Buglet in tcIface, now that nested binders can have...
commit
|
commitdiff
2010-10-25
simonpj@microsoft.com
Serialise nested unfoldings across module boundaries
commit
|
commitdiff
2010-10-15
Simon Marlow
Fix #4346 (INLINABLE pragma not behaving consistently)
commit
|
commitdiff
2010-10-07
simonpj@microsoft.com
Implement auto-specialisation of imported Ids
commit
|
commitdiff
2010-09-18
Ian Lynagh
Add separate functions for querying DynFlag and Extensi...
commit
|
commitdiff
2010-09-15
simonpj@microsoft.com
Implement INLINABLE pragma
commit
|
commitdiff
2010-09-14
simonpj@microsoft.com
Improve ASSERT
commit
|
commitdiff
2010-09-13
simonpj@microsoft.com
Super-monster patch implementing the new typechecker...
commit
|
commitdiff
2010-05-31
simonpj@microsoft.com
Robustify the treatement of DFunUnfolding
commit
|
commitdiff
2010-03-20
Ian Lynagh
Remove LazyUniqFM; fixes trac #3880
commit
|
commitdiff
2010-01-06
simonpj@microsoft.com
Improve the handling of default methods
commit
|
commitdiff
2009-12-11
simonpj@microsoft.com
Bottom extraction: float out bottoming expressions...
commit
|
commitdiff
2009-12-02
simonpj@microsoft.com
More work on the simplifier's inlining strategies
commit
|
commitdiff
2009-11-19
simonpj@microsoft.com
Remove the (very) old strictness analyser
commit
|
commitdiff
2009-11-19
simonpj@microsoft.com
Implement -fexpose-all-unfoldings, and fix a non-termin...
commit
|
commitdiff
2009-10-29
simonpj@microsoft.com
The Big INLINE Patch: totally reorganise way that INLIN...
commit
|
commitdiff
2009-10-15
simonpj@microsoft.com
Fix Trac #959: a long-standing bug in instantiating...
commit
|
commitdiff
2009-07-07
Ian Lynagh
Remove unused imports
commit
|
commitdiff
2009-06-25
simonpj@microsoft.com
Fix Trac #3323: naughty record selectors again
commit
|
commitdiff
2009-01-13
simonpj@microsoft.com
Fix Trac #2937: deserialising assoicated type definitions
commit
|
commitdiff
2009-01-02
simonpj@microsoft.com
Make record selectors into ordinary functions
commit
|
commitdiff
2008-12-30
simonpj@microsoft.com
Avoid nasty name clash with associated data types ...
commit
|
commitdiff
2008-12-16
Simon Marlow
Rollback INLINE patches
commit
|
commitdiff
2008-12-05
simonpj@microsoft.com
Completely new treatment of INLINE pragmas (big patch)
commit
|
commitdiff
2008-10-30
simonpj@microsoft.com
Add (a) CoreM monad, (b) new Annotations feature
commit
|
commitdiff
2008-09-23
simonpj@microsoft.com
Allow type families to use GADT syntax (and be GADTs)
commit
|
commitdiff
2008-10-03
simonpj@microsoft.com
Add ASSERTs to all calls of nameModule
commit
|
commitdiff
2008-08-11
simonpj@microsoft.com
Fix Trac #2412: type synonyms and hs-boot recursion
commit
|
commitdiff
2008-07-31
Max Bolingbroke
Follow OccName changes and minor refactorings in TcIface
commit
|
commitdiff
2008-07-31
Max Bolingbroke
Split the Id related functions out from Var into Id...
commit
|
commitdiff
2008-07-20
Thomas Schilling
Fix Haddock errors.
commit
|
commitdiff
2008-07-07
simonpj@microsoft.com
White space only
commit
|
commitdiff
2008-05-04
Ian Lynagh
Make TcIface warning-free
commit
|
commitdiff
2008-04-12
Ian Lynagh
(F)SLIT -> (f)sLit in TcIface
commit
|
commitdiff
2008-03-29
Ian Lynagh
Don't import FastString in HsVersions.h
commit
|
commitdiff
2008-03-29
Ian Lynagh
DEBUG removal
commit
|
commitdiff
2008-03-29
Ian Lynagh
Remove an #ifdef DEBUG
commit
|
commitdiff
2008-03-06
simonpj@microsoft.com
Don't expose the unfolding of dictionary selectors...
commit
|
commitdiff
2008-02-07
Ian Lynagh
Convert more UniqFM's back to LazyUniqFM's
commit
|
commitdiff
2008-01-17
Twan van Laarhoven
Monadify iface/TcIface: use do, return, applicative...
commit
|
commitdiff
2007-12-14
Roman Leshchinskiy
Fix bug in VectInfo loading
commit
|
commitdiff
2007-09-05
Simon Marlow
FIX #1650: ".boot modules interact badly with the ghci...
commit
|
commitdiff
2007-09-04
Ian Lynagh
Fix CodingStyle#Warnings URLs
commit
|
commitdiff
2007-09-03
Ian Lynagh
Use OPTIONS rather than OPTIONS_GHC for pragmas
commit
|
commitdiff
2007-09-01
Ian Lynagh
Add {-# OPTIONS_GHC -w #-} and some blurb to all compil...
commit
|
commitdiff
2007-08-03
Roman Leshchinskiy
Make sure PA dfuns are keyed on the vectorised tycon...
commit
|
commitdiff
2007-08-03
Roman Leshchinskiy
Add PA dfuns to VectInfo
commit
|
commitdiff
2007-08-01
simonpj@microsoft.com
Fix a knot-tying bug with ghc --make
commit
|
commitdiff
2007-07-16
Roman Leshchinskiy
Adapt interface file code for vectorisation
commit
|
commitdiff
2007-07-11
andy@galois.com
Adding tick boxes to the interface syntax; fixes #1510
commit
|
commitdiff
2007-06-06
simonpj@microsoft.com
Remove unnecessary free-variables from renamer
commit
|
commitdiff
2007-05-22
Manuel M T Chakravarty
Add data type information to VectInfo
commit
|
commitdiff
2007-05-15
Manuel M T Chakravarty
Iface representation of synonym family instances
commit
|
commitdiff
2007-05-11
Manuel M T Chakravarty
Remove the distinction between data and newtype families
commit
|
commitdiff
2007-05-11
Simon Marlow
Store a SrcSpan instead of a SrcLoc inside a Name
commit
|
commitdiff
2007-05-08
Manuel M T Chakravarty
Improved VectInfo
commit
|
commitdiff
2007-05-07
Manuel M T Chakravarty
Add VectInfo to HPT
commit
|
commitdiff
2007-04-25
Manuel M T Chakravarty
Generating synonym instance representation tycons
commit
|
commitdiff
2007-04-25
simonpj@microsoft.com
Retain inline-pragma information on unfoldings in inter...
commit
|
commitdiff
2007-04-17
Simon Marlow
Re-working of the breakpoint support
commit
|
commitdiff
2007-03-30
simonpj@microsoft.com
The ru_local field of a CoreRule is False for implicit Ids
commit
|
commitdiff
2007-03-16
simonpj@microsoft.com
Refactor TcRnDriver, and check exports on hi-boot files
commit
|
commitdiff
2007-02-23
Manuel M T Chakravarty
Moved argument position info of ATs into tycon rhs...
commit
|
commitdiff
2007-02-21
simonpj@microsoft.com
Deal more correctly with orphan instances
commit
|
commitdiff
2007-01-11
simonpj@microsoft.com
Update comments
commit
|
commitdiff
2006-12-10
Pepe Iborra
Breakpoint code instrumentation
commit
|
commitdiff
2006-11-29
andy@galois.com
TickBox representation change
commit
|
commitdiff
2006-10-24
andy@galois.com
Haskell Program Coverage
commit
|
commitdiff
2006-10-24
Simon Marlow
fix indentation wibble to make it compile with 5.04
commit
|
commitdiff
2006-10-13
simonpj@microsoft.com
Add assertion checks for mkCoVar/mkTyVar
commit
|
commitdiff
2006-10-11
Simon Marlow
Module header tidyup, phase 1
commit
|
commitdiff
2006-10-11
Simon Marlow
Interface file optimisation and removal of nameParent
commit
|
commitdiff
2006-10-10
Manuel M T Chakravarty
Rough matches for family instances
commit
|
commitdiff
2006-10-06
simonpj@microsoft.com
Fix up the typechecking of interface files during ...
commit
|
commitdiff
2006-10-04
simonpj@microsoft.com
Improve pretty printing slightly
commit
|
commitdiff
2006-09-23
simonpj@microsoft.com
Trim imports, and remove some dead code
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Import/export of data constructors in family instances
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Get of fam inst index in ifaces
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Straightened out implicit coercions for indexed types
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Fixed two bugs concerning fanilies
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Introduce coercions for data instance decls
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Extend TyCons and DataCons to represent data instance...
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Extended TyCon and friends to represent family declarations
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Add missing co_vars to tcIfaceDataAlt
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Complete OccName->FS change in TcIface
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
make dataConInstPat take a list of FastStrings rather...
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Fix problem with selectors for GADT records with unboxe...
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
Fix bug in type checking interface DataAlts
commit
|
commitdiff
2006-09-20
Manuel M T Chakravarty
fixing record selectors
commit
|
commitdiff
next